Output 309765633cd10b210175016c8aec2fe56c5115d4f49bfe22459a3cb4d9fd1d6d:0

value
968514
script pubkey
OP_0 OP_PUSHBYTES_20 f15e348f32cd780bca9b0358a4b12469458c7810
address
bc1q790rfreje4uqhj5mqdv2fvfyd9zcc7qsf48835
transaction
309765633cd10b210175016c8aec2fe56c5115d4f49bfe22459a3cb4d9fd1d6d
confirmations
1080
spent
true